Bauchi Governor Bala Mohammed meets Oyo Governor Makinde on school abductions
Bauchi State Governor Bala Mohammed travelled to Ibadan on Sunday and met Oyo State Governor Seyi Makinde at the latter’s residence. Accompanied by leaders of the Allied People’s Movement, including national chairman Yusuf Mamman Dantalle and governorship candidate Yakubu Adamu, Mohammed expressed solidarity with Oyo over the recent kidnapping of teachers and pupils in the Yawota and Esinele communities of Oriire Local Government Area.
He praised Makinde’s efforts to secure the release of the abducted victims and urged continued action, stating, “We are here to encourage him that what he is doing to ensure their release is being noticed by the whole nation.” Mohammed also called for a review and restructuring of Nigeria’s security architecture to better protect citizens and improve coordination among security agencies.
The meeting underscored growing concerns about banditry and school kidnappings in Nigeria’s northwest, with both governors pledging further cooperation to ensure the safe return of the hostages.
